Warning Signs You Need Skylight Leak Water Removal

The sooner you catch skylight leaks, the less damage they’ll cause and the less expensive it’ll be to fix.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show water damage or mold grow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ains and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a skylight leak. Don’t ignore these signs, or they’ll spread and cause more damage.

Peeling Paint and Warped Wood

Peeling paint or warped wood can show water damage or rot. If you notice these signs, it’s time to call us to prevent further damage.

Unexplained Puddles or Leaks

Unexplained puddles or leaks around your skylight can be a sign of a leak. Don’t wait to call us, or you’ll risk further damage and costly repairs.

Mold Growth and Black Spots

Mold growth or black spots can show water damage or poor ventilation. If you notice these signs, it’s time to call us to prevent further damage and health risks.

Skylight Leak Water Removal Cost in Ballico, CA

The cost of skylight leak water removal can vary based on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ballico, CA. These are estimates, not guarantees, and ex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$200-$500 Size of affected area and complexity of leak
Water Extraction $500-$2,000 Amount of water extracted and equipment used
Drying and Dehumidification $500-$2,000 Size of affected area and duration of drying process
Restoration and Repairs $1,000-$5,000 Amount of damage and materials needed for repairs
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200-$500 Size of affected area and complexity of cleaning process

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ballico, CA. We offer free estimates for all our services.

Common Questions About Skylight Leak Water Removal

Q: What causes skylight leaks?

A: Skylight le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including clogged gutters, damaged or rotten skylight frames, and high winds or heavy rainfall. Our team will work closely with you to find out the cause of the leak and prevent further damage.

Q: How long does skylight leak water removal take?

A: The length of time it takes to remove water from a skylight leak can vary depending on the severity of the leak and the size of the affected area.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age.

Q: Do I need to vacate my home during the restoration process?

A: In most cases, you can remain in your home during the restoration process. But, in some cases, we may need to ask you to vacate the premises to ensure your safety and the safety of our technicians.
